MAY 18
The Mind vs. the Brain
“Finally, brethren, whatsoever things are true, whatsoever things are honest, whatsoever things are just, whatsoever things are pure, whatsoever things are lovely, whatsoever things are of good report; if there be any virtue, and if there be any praise, think on these things.” Philippians 4:8
Did you know there is a difference between your mind and your brain? The brain is what the mind thinks with. The relationship of the mind and the brain is very similar to the relationship of a pianist and a piano. The piano is the brain and the pianist is the mind.
The most dangerous thing in the world is a man with a bad mind and a good brain. He is a clever devil.
When you get saved, you don’t get a new brain. You get a new mind. And the god of this world will do all he can to distort your mind. Why? Because Proverbs 23:7 says, “For as he thinks in his heart, so is he.”
Dwell today on the true, the honest, the just, the pure, the lovely—think on virtue and praise. Pray for missionaries serving the Lord in other countries – that they will dwell on the truths of the Lord and that their walks will be strong and undeterred from the Lord’s mission.

MAY 19
Grateful—for We Are Blessed!
“Be careful for nothing; but in every thing by prayer and supplication with thanksgiving let your requests be made known unto God.” Philippians 4:6
Sometimes we complain when we shouldn’t.
I remember one time driving across the country with a gentleman. At the time, all of our children were in private schools and Joyce and I were “dying of maltuition.” I began complaining a little bit to the man about the great cost of sending a son to college.
He looked at me and said, “I’d give anything in the world if my son would go to college.”
I thought, “Oh, what an ungrateful spirit I have!”
Do you ever complain about dirty dishes? There are lots of folks in Third World countries that would like to have some dirty dishes. We are to be thankful in all things.
Rejoice in God’s blessings in your life. Nip that temptation in the bud to complain and grumble about your life today.

MAY 20
Letting God Work In and Through You
“For it is God which worketh in you both to will and to do of His good pleasure.” Philippians 2:13
One of the greatest secrets I have ever learned is this: God doesn’t want me to do anything for Him. He wants to do something through me.
People say, “Well, I just serve God in my poor, little, old weak way.” I feel like saying, “Well, quit it. He doesn’t want you to serve Him in your poor, little, old weak way. He wants you out of the way, so He can flow through you!”
We need to make ourselves available to God and say, “God, I’m tired of being inhibited. I want to be inhabited by You. I want You to live Your life through me.”
Where have you been standing in the way of God instead of surrendering to God and letting Him live through you?
